application / x-www-form-urlencoded и charset = «utf-8»?

Принято ли опускать;charset="utf-8" когда тип контента?application/x-www-form-urlencoded

В частности, при использованииaccept-charset="utf-8" в теге формы я бы ожидал некоторого указания, что в заголовках используется utf-8, но яЯ не вижу никого.

Вот мой простой тест в Chrome. Страница формы:







Your name:




И заголовки для сгенерированного запроса:

POST /printenv.cgi HTTP/1.1
Host: ...:8000
Connection: keep-alive
Content-Length: 19
Cache-Control: max-age=0
Accept: text/html,application/xhtml+xml,application/xml;q=0.9,*/*;q=0.8
Origin: http://...:8000
User-Agent: Mozilla/5.0 (Windows NT 6.1; WOW64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/27.0.1453.94 Safari/537.36
Content-Type: application/x-www-form-urlencoded
Referer: http://...:8000/utf8-test.html
Accept-Encoding: gzip,deflate,sdch
Accept-Language: en-US,en;q=0.8

Какие'Является ли соглашение для определения того, как кодируются значения параметров формы?

Ответы на вопрос(2)

Ваш ответ на вопрос